Pitcher W-L ERA SO BB IP Tuesday (5/25) (UE) vs. R Sr. Nathan Forer (SIU) Next Starter L Jr. Randy Hoelscher (SIU) The Southern Illinois baseball team heads to the 2010 State Farm Missouri Valley Conference Tournament as a No. 4 seed. The Salukis face fifth-seeded Evansville on Tuesday at 4 p.m. at Eck Stadium in Wichita, Kan. SIU goes to the MVC Tournament for the 28th time in school history. The Salukis are all-time in MVC Tournament games. SIU is making its 12th conference tournament in 16 years under head coach Dan Callahan. Callahan s teams are in postseason play, with the 2003 and 2004 clubs finishing runner-up to Wichita State. SIU has not won a MVC regular season or tournament title since That year, the Salukis went overall and 14-6 in league play, won the conference tournament and advanced to the NCAA Regional where they were eliminated by San Diego State. Since then, the closest SIU came to winning a MVC Tournament was when it finished second in both 2003 and The Salukis went undefeated through their first three games before falling twice to Wichita State in the championship round of those tournaments. SIU has never gone to a MVC Tournament higher than a three-seed in 12 trips under head coach Dan Callahan. Callahan s clubs were seeded third in 1996, 2003 and 2005; fourth in 2002, 2004, 2007 and 2010; fifth in 1997, 2006, 2008 and 2009; and sixth in The Salukis were seeded third and fourth when they finished runner-up in the 2003 and 2004 tournaments, respectively. Going back to 1981, the Salukis have been the No. 1 seed twice (1981 and 1984), the No. 2 seed twice; third five times; fourth five times; fifth six times; and No. 6 three times. SIU has won a total of five MVC Tournament titles (1976, 1977, 1978, 1981, 1990), all of which came under Richard Itchy Jones. Jones guided the Salukis to a record and three College World Series appearances from SIU s five titles are fourth-most among current league members. Wichita State (17), Bradley (6) and Indiana State (6) rank ahead of the Dawgs. Head coach Dan Callahan is a combined 9-22 against Wichita State (1-11), Missouri State (3-5), Creighton (2-2), Evansville (2-3) and Indiana State (1-1) at the MVC Tournament. Callahan has never faced Illinois State or Bradley in the postseason. 3 SIU and Evansville - The Series Southern Illinois and Evansville first met in 1947 and the two schools have played 142 games against one another as they enter the MVC Tournament. Southern Illinois leads the all-time series, 88-54, and has won nine of the last 10 games. Head coach Dan Callahan has a career record against the Purple Aces. Callahan is 2-3 against Evansville in the MVC Tournament and the last time the two school met in the postseason was in The Purple Aces took that game 10-0, but SIU won 10-9 in 2005 and 11-1 in In 1996, the first-ever meeting between SIU and Evansville in the Valley Tournament, the Purple Aces defeated the Dawgs Those 29 runs given up are the most allowed in a game in school history. DAY (28-27) Monday No Scheduled Monday Games Tuesday 5-2 Wednesday 3-4 Thursday 2-0 Friday 4-9 Saturday 5-9 Sunday 7-3 MONTH (28-27) February 2-3 March 9-11 April 9-8 May 8-5 Running into the Tournament Southern Illinois enters the 2010 Missouri Valley Conference Tournament having won five out of its last six games. The streak started when SIU took the final two games from Evansville on May SIU then beat Saint Louis, 16-5, one week ago this Tuesday and took 2-of-3 at Missouri State. The Salukis have hit.358 in their last six games where they averaged nine runs per game and 13.5 hits. SIU had 14 doubles and nine home runs in that time -- four that came off Tyler Bullock s bat. Southern won the five games in a variety of ways. The Dawgs had two double-digit wins; two, two-run victories; and one, one-run win. SIU s lone loss was on Saturday at Missouri State and it was a 6-5 defeat in 10 innings. The Dawgs started the year off with a 2-6 record and stood at 5-11 after a four-game losing streak from March Southern rebounded by winning 10-of- 13 games from March 19-April 6 and that stretch was capped off with a six-game winning streak to get its overall record at That was the first time all year the Dawgs had a winning record. SIU didn t stay above.500 for long and a 2-8 record in its next 10 games put its record down at Southern s five-game losing streak in that time (April 14-20) is its longest of the season. Much like they did in 2009 when they won eight of their final nine league games, the Salukis finished the 2010 regular season on fire. SIU has won 11 of its last 16 games heading into the MVC Tournament. All-Conference Honorees Southern Illinois sophomore first baseman Chris Serritella was the only Salukis named to the All-Missouri Valley Conference first team. This is the 56th time in program history that a Saluki was named first team All- MVC and the 20th time under head coach Dan Callahan. Joining Serritella on the allconference lists were second team honorees Chris Murphy (OF), Nathan Forer (SP) and Bryant George (RP). Tyler Bullock (DH), Austin Montgomery (UT) and Randy Hoelscher (SP) were named honorable mention All-MVC. For George, the school s all-time leader in career appearances and saves, this marks the third time in four years he has garnered all-conference recognition. He was a first team pick in 2009 and an honorable mention selection in George and Bullock were both first team preseason all-conference picks this year and Bullock follows his 2009 first team nod as a designated hitter with his honorable mention selection this year. Bullock Powers His Way into Record Books Senior catcher Tyler Bullock enters the 2010 Missouri Valley Conference Tournament having hit three home runs in his last two games. His power surge moved him ahead of Chris Serritella, who has led the team in homers since Feb. 28, for the team home run lead. Bullock now has 14 home runs this year and 31 for his career, as he became just the second Saluki in program history to hit more than 30 home runs. He is now five home runs shy of Robert Jones ( ) school record of 36. Bullock, who led the Dawgs with six homers in 2008 and 11 in 2009, is also looking to join Jones as the only Salukis to lead the club in home runs three years in a row. Bullock has nine RBIs in his last three games. Five of those came in last Friday s game at Missouri State, when set a new career-high for runs driven in. He also hit two home runs in the game, giving him his second two-homer game this year and fourth of his career. George Gets SIU Appearance Record With two appearances last weekend at Missouri State, senior closer Bryant George moved ahead of Daniel Wells ( ) for the most appearances in school history. George made his 98th and record-breaking 99th appearance against the Bears. He recorded his 30th career save as he tied Wells school record on Friday, but drew the loss in his record-breaking appearance on Saturday. George threw 2.2 innings with three strikeouts, but gave up the winning hit in the 10th inning. That run was the first he s allowed in his last nine appearances. George, who also is SIU s all-time saves leader, has five saves in nine appearances this May. He has a 5.40 ERA this year with 46 strikeouts in 46.2 innings pitched. 5 12th in School History With his one hit in Saturday s regular season finale, sophomore first baseman Chris Serritella became the 12th Saluki in program history with 80 or more hits in a season. Serritella s 63 RBIs are tied for the fourthmost in a year in program history, his 13 home runs are tied for the seventh-most and his 138 total bases are the fourth-most. The Glenview, Ill. native that is SIU s lone first team all-conference selection ranks second in the MVC this year with 19 multiple-rbi games and his 20-game hitting streak from April 6 through May 15 is the third longest recorded by a Valley player this year. In 24 games from April 6-May 18, Serritella hit an astonishing.441. He had 41 hits in that time with 23 runs scored, 11 doubles, four home run and 30 RBIs. However, this past weekend at Missouri State he finally came back down to earth. He went just 3-for-15 with five strikeouts, only two RBIs and he didn t have a single extra-base hit. After a couple of rough starts, at least by his standards, Forer returned to his top form in his last outing at Missouri State. Against Middle Tennessee on May 7, Forer allowed a season-high seven earned runs in his shortest start of the year (3.1 innings). He drew the loss in his next start on May 14, which came to Evansville when he allowed four earned runs in six innings. Asides from those two starts, the senior ace had only yielded more than two earned runs in one of his first six starts. This past Thursday, Forer returned to his dominant self, as he only surrendered one run in seven innings against the Bears. That was his fifth start this season where he yielded one or no earned runs. His ERA dropped down to 2.93 as he picked up his third win on the year. Stalter Getting Hot at the Right Time Senior shortstop Michael Stalter has raised his batting average 40 points since his last at-bat in SIU s April 28 game at Eastern Illinois. That AB was a crucial one for the Dawgs, as his two-run homer in the 10th inning won the game for the Salukis in Charleston, Ill. That was Stalter s first home run of the season and he has hit two more since that game at EIU. Both home runs came last week, as he belted one against Saint Louis on May 18 and hit another in the first game of the Missouri State series. Stalter has the second-highest batting average (.386) on the team in the last 15 games where he has hit five doubles, driven in 11 runs and has a.632 slugging percentage. He also has five multiple-hit games in the last 15 outings and on May 20 at MSU, Stalter matched his season- and career-high with four hits. He went 4-for-5 at the plate with a double, home run, one RBI and he tied his career-high with four runs scored. Last year Stalter hit.295 (one point above his current batting average), but was SIU s top hitter in the 2009 MVC Tournament. In the three games (two losses, one win), Stalter went 6-for-11. Hoelscher to Start SIU s Second Game in Valley Tournament Junior left-handed pitcher Randy Hoelscher will start SIU s second game in the Valley Tournament. Hoelscher has been Southern s most successful pitcher in MVC games, where he has a 3-0 record and a 4.24 ERA. The Salukis have won four of the six Valley games that he started. The Springfield College transfer had a slow start in his Division I career. In his first four starts he had a 0-2 record and ERA. Since then he has been very commanding on the hill and has shaved 9.71 points off his ERA. In his last eight starts, Hoelscher has only walked five of the 223 batters that he s faced and has given up no walks in five of those eight starts. The lefty s had a 5-to-1 strikeout-to-walk ratio since March 27 and is coming off his season-best six strikeouts that he posted against Missouri State last Friday. It marked his first homer of the season and the first time he s led off a game by going yard. Murphy and Michael Stalter tied for the team lead, as they both went 6-for-14 in the final series before the MVC Tournament. In the opening game of the MSU series, Murphy went 2-for-5 with two runs scored and he matched his season-high with three RBIs. After a rough start in May that saw him go 4-for-31 in the first eight games of the month, Murphy has since rebounded and is batting.375 with seven runs scored and six driven in during the last five games leading up to the tournament. Murphy is one of three players with 20 or more multiple-hit games this year. He had two or more hits in each of his first six games this season and had 10 multi-hit games in his first 16 games. As Murphy has gone this season, so has Southern Illinois. The Dawgs have a 15-6 record when he has at least two hits in a game. Murphy is batting.315 in the 28 Saluki victories this season with 18 RBIs and 11 doubles, but hits.295 with 10 RBIs and four doubles in the 27 losses. 7 The Walk-On with the Big Numbers Saluki junior second baseman Blake Pinnon, who walked on at SIU in the middle of fall ball, leads the team with 24 multiple-hit games this season and he brings a sevengame hitting streak with him to Wichita for the Valley Tournament. He is batting.433 in the last seven games with two doubles, one RBI and has scored nine runs. Pinnon, who never hit higher than.294 in junior college, is second on the team in batting average (.345), hits (69) and doubles (16). He is also tied for second in RBIs (44) and is third in home runs (eight). Bajer Takes Over Behind the Plate Sophomore catcher Brian Bajer has taken over as the primary catcher for the Salukis. He has started behind the plate in 14 of the last 25 games and nine of the last 15 games before the Valley Tournament. Bajer s production at the plate has really stepped up over the course of the last 15 games. He is batting.351 in that time with two doubles, a home run, six runs scored and seven driven in. SIU has won nine out of the last 10 times he has been the starting catcher. The Butler transfer, who had to sit out last seasons due to NCAA transfer regulations, is batting.333 this year with three doubles, four home runs and 16 RBI in 34 games played. Big Innings Southern Illinois has scored five or more runs in an inning 13 times this year, but opponents have scored five or more runs in 13 different innings as well. The most runs that SIU scored in an inning this year is the 10 they put up in the sixth inning of its March 30, 15-3 win over UT Martin in Carbondale. Indiana State scored 12 runs in the second inning in its 14-4 win over the Dawgs in Carbondale on April 23. This-N-That The 2010 season marks the 20th anniversary since SIU s last MVC regular season and MVC Tournament Championship. That year the Dawgs went and 4-1 in the conference tournament that was held in Wichita. Southern Illinois has hit 14 doubles in its last six games. The Salukis have hit at least one double in 47 of 55 games this year and have had two or more doubles in 31 of 55 games this season. Eight of senior catcher/designated hitter Tyler Bullock s 14 home runs this year came in Valley play. The Salukis need two more wins to have their 26th, 30-win season in program history. SIU came into the year having won 30 or more ball games in four of the last five seasons and the one year the Dawgs didn t net 30 wins was in 2009 (24-28 overall record). Head coach Dan Callahan enters the MVC Tournament with 595 career wins in 22 seasons as a Division I head coach (16 years at SIU; six at Eastern Illinois). Southern Illinois has hit 52 home runs hits year, which marks just the fourth time in the last 20 years that the Dawgs have hit at least 50 in a season.
